/**
 * Default implementation of the {@link UserConfiguration}.
 */
@Component(service = {UserConfiguration.class, SecurityConfiguration.class})
@Designate(ocd = UserConfigurationImpl.Configuration.class)
public class UserConfigurationImpl extends ConfigurationBase implements UserConfiguration, SecurityConfiguration {

    @ObjectClassDefinition(name = "Apache Jackrabbit Oak UserConfiguration")
    @interface Configuration {
        @AttributeDefinition(
                name = "User Path",
                description = "Path underneath which user nodes are being created.")
        String usersPath() default UserConstants.DEFAULT_USER_PATH;

        @AttributeDefinition(
                name = "Group Path",
                description = "Path underneath which group nodes are being created.")
        String groupsPath() default UserConstants.DEFAULT_GROUP_PATH;

        @AttributeDefinition(
                name = "System User Relative Path",
                description = "Path relative to the user root path underneath which system user nodes are being " +
                        "created. The default value is 'system'.")
        String systemRelativePath() default UserConstants.DEFAULT_SYSTEM_RELATIVE_PATH;

        @AttributeDefinition(
                name = "Default Depth",
                description = "Number of levels that are used by default to store authorizable nodes")
        int defaultDepth() default UserConstants.DEFAULT_DEPTH;

        @AttributeDefinition(
                name = "Import Behavior",
                description = "Behavior for user/group related items upon XML import.",
                options = {
                        @Option(label = ImportBehavior.NAME_ABORT, value = ImportBehavior.NAME_ABORT),
                        @Option(label = ImportBehavior.NAME_BESTEFFORT, value = ImportBehavior.NAME_BESTEFFORT),
                        @Option(label = ImportBehavior.NAME_IGNORE, value = ImportBehavior.NAME_IGNORE)
                })
        String importBehavior() default ImportBehavior.NAME_IGNORE;

        @AttributeDefinition(
                name = "Hash Algorithm",
                description = "Name of the algorithm used to generate the password hash.")
        String passwordHashAlgorithm() default PasswordUtil.DEFAULT_ALGORITHM;

        @AttributeDefinition(
                name = "Hash Iterations",
                description = "Number of iterations to generate the password hash.")
        int passwordHashIterations() default PasswordUtil.DEFAULT_ITERATIONS;

        @AttributeDefinition(
                name = "Hash Salt Size",
                description = "Salt size to generate the password hash.")
        int passwordSaltSize() default PasswordUtil.DEFAULT_SALT_SIZE;

        @AttributeDefinition(
                name = "Omit Admin Password",
                description = "Boolean flag to prevent the administrator account to be created with a password " +
                        "upon repository initialization. Please note that changing this option after the initial " +
                        "repository setup will have no effect.")
        boolean omitAdminPw() default false;

        @AttributeDefinition(
                name = "Autosave Support",
                description = "Configuration option to enable autosave behavior. Note: this config option is " +
                        "present for backwards compatibility with Jackrabbit 2.x and should only be used for " +
                        "broken code that doesn't properly verify the autosave behavior (see Jackrabbit API). " +
                        "If this option is turned on autosave will be enabled by default; otherwise autosave is " +
                        "not supported.")
        boolean supportAutoSave() default false;

        @AttributeDefinition(
                name = "Maximum Password Age",
                description = "Maximum age in days a password may have. Values greater 0 will implicitly enable " +
                        "password expiry. A value of 0 indicates unlimited password age.")
        int passwordMaxAge() default UserConstants.DEFAULT_PASSWORD_MAX_AGE;

        @AttributeDefinition(
                name = "Change Password On First Login",
                description = "When enabled, forces users to change their password upon first login.")
        boolean initialPasswordChange() default UserConstants.DEFAULT_PASSWORD_INITIAL_CHANGE;

        @AttributeDefinition(
                name = "Maximum Password History Size",
                description = "Maximum number of passwords recorded for a user after changing her password (NOTE: " +
                        "upper limit is 1000). When changing the password the new password must not be present in the " +
                        "password history. A value of 0 indicates no password history is recorded.")
        int passwordHistorySize() default UserConstants.PASSWORD_HISTORY_DISABLED_SIZE;

        @AttributeDefinition(
                name = "Enable Password Expiry for Admin User",
                description = "When enabled, the admin user will also be subject to password expiry. The default value is false for backwards compatibility."
        )
        boolean passwordExpiryForAdmin() default false;

        @AttributeDefinition(
                name = "Principal Cache Expiration",
                description = "Optional configuration defining the number of milliseconds " +
                        "until the principal cache expires (NOTE: currently only respected for principal resolution " +
                        "with the internal system session such as used for login). If not set or equal/lower than zero " +
                        "no caches are created/evaluated.")
        long cacheExpiration() default UserPrincipalProvider.EXPIRATION_NO_CACHE;

        @AttributeDefinition(
                name = "RFC7613 Username Comparison Profile",
                description = "Enable the UsercaseMappedProfile defined in RFC7613 for username comparison.")
        boolean enableRFC7613UsercaseMappedProfile() default false;
    }
